/**
* Use this helper function as a workaround for the `EntityPlayer.GetPocketItem` method not working
* correctly.
*
* Note that due to API limitations, there is no way to determine the location of a Dice Bag trinket
* dice. Furthermore, when the player has a Dice Bag trinket dice and a pocket active at the same
* time, there is no way to determine the location of the pocket active item. If this function
* cannot determine the identity of a particular slot, it will mark the type of the slot as
* `PocketItemType.UNDETERMINABLE`.
*/
export function getPocketItems(
player: EntityPlayer,
): readonly PocketItemDescription[] {
const pocketItem = player.GetActiveItem(ActiveSlot.POCKET);
const hasPocketItem = pocketItem !== CollectibleType.NULL;
const pocketItem2 = player.GetActiveItem(ActiveSlot.POCKET_SINGLE_USE);
const hasPocketItem2 = pocketItem2 !== CollectibleType.NULL;
const maxPocketItems = player.GetMaxPocketItems();
const pocketItems: PocketItemDescription[] = [];
let pocketItemIdentified = false;
let pocketItem2Identified = false;
for (const slot of POCKET_ITEM_SLOT_VALUES) {
const cardType = player.GetCard(slot);
const pillColor = player.GetPill(slot);
if (cardType !== CardType.NULL) {
pocketItems.push({
slot,
type: PocketItemType.CARD,
subType: cardType,
});
} else if (pillColor !== PillColor.NULL) {
pocketItems.push({
slot,
type: PocketItemType.PILL,
subType: pillColor,
});
} else if (hasPocketItem && !hasPocketItem2 && !pocketItemIdentified) {
pocketItemIdentified = true;
pocketItems.push({
slot,
type: PocketItemType.ACTIVE_ITEM,
subType: pocketItem,
});
} else if (!hasPocketItem && hasPocketItem2 && !pocketItem2Identified) {
pocketItem2Identified = true;
pocketItems.push({
slot,
type: PocketItemType.DICE_BAG_DICE,
subType: pocketItem2,
});
} else if (hasPocketItem && hasPocketItem2) {
pocketItems.push({
slot,
type: PocketItemType.UNDETERMINABLE,
subType: 0,
});
} else {
pocketItems.push({
slot,
type: PocketItemType.EMPTY,
subType: 0,
});
}
if (slot + 1 === maxPocketItems) {
break;
}
}
return pocketItems;
}
/**
* Returns whether the player can hold an additional pocket item, beyond what they are currently
* carrying. This takes into account items that modify the max number of pocket items, like Starter
* Deck.
*
* If the player is the Tainted Soul, this always returns false, since that character cannot pick up
* items. (Only Tainted Forgotten can pick up items.)
*/
export function hasOpenPocketItemSlot(player: EntityPlayer): boolean {
if (isCharacter(player, PlayerType.SOUL_B)) {
return false;
}
const pocketItems = getPocketItems(player);
return pocketItems.some(
(pocketItem) => pocketItem.type === PocketItemType.EMPTY,
);
}
